I've got Progress bars. My first suspension mod and it provided a very different feel on the track.

You have to remember with these things is that you have to have something you're trying to correct. With me I wanted to correct the understeer slightly while getting less body roll. I managed to do that pretty quickly with just the sway bars. The fronts are 3-way adjustable and the rears are 2-way adjustable. What you can do with these is experiment on them at autocross to find out what kind of response from the car you want (ie more understeer, more oversteer, a truly 'neutral' setting, etc.) but the problem is that if you add other things (shocks, strut tower bars, wheels/tires) they will also adjust the way the car responds so if you add something and you lose what you gained from the sways you'll have to adjust those.

In the end though my car is a shitload stiffer side to side and up and down, I have almost the same driving behavior (slight understeer) that you have with the stock setup, which means I can go a helluva lot faster while still not sliding.

Ryan: Did you have endlinks and bushings also? I was looking at the progress sways, but really don't know too much about them.
They came with bushings that i used. I probably wouldn't reuse them and would pick up a new set from Summit if I got used sways.

I have the sways with my stock endlinks. They work fine but allegedly with the stiffer A/M suspension they tend to break occasionaly.

I was going to replace them with RB endlinks prior to deciding to part it out. The RBs are inexpensive but they require drilling into the progress sways for fitment (just need to widen the holes). You can get other endlinks for a little more that don't require drilling but lots of people have the RBs so there are plenty of DIYs
